RE: We are on our way to becoming Greece. Trump is the cure.
If the cure is to default on our debts, be prepared for soaring interest rates and a devalued dollar. It would undermine confidence in the worlds most trusted financial asset — our currency.
Even a partial default would mean that tax dollars would have to go toward repaying the debt.
Of course, Many investors would shift their money elsewhere. And the economy could endure a traumatic blow.
And if you have a conservative 401K that invests in treasuries ( as most of those who are close to retiring have ), your portfolio will be devastated.
This will also be historically unprecedented. The move would end a policy introduced during the presidency of George Washington and celebrated in the Pulitzer Prize-winning Broadway musical Hamilton” to pay full face value on the debts incurred by the country.
The governments unfailing payments of its debt have long pleased investors and supported the economy because the country can borrow at lower rates than it otherwise could.
Defaulting on our debt would cause creditors to rightly question the full faith commitment we make.
